Loan Admin Support Specialist

Capital Farm Credit is the largest rural lending cooperative in Texas, dedicated to supporting rural communities and agriculture. The Loan Admin Support Specialist is responsible for loan administration and providing customer service support related to loan servicing efforts, ensuring compliance with procedures and regulations.

Responsibilities

Provides excellent customer service on a consistent basis by answering customer inquiries by phone or email and facilitating communications between internal departments and external parties. Researches and resolves issues with limited assistance
Conducts appropriate searches within various systems for loan termination data, initial lien filing data, subsequent lien filings and impact of such to initial lien, and collateral lien position
Enters pertinent loan data into loan origination system for release of lien credit servicing actions for all terminated, real estate secured loans in the Association. Submits servicing action file to the Document Preparation Department. Reviews documents for accuracy and completeness. Communicates with internal or external parties on additional needs. Files documents in electronic repository in accordance with procedures
Submits releases for recording in the county using electronic means where possible or mails releases to title company/county for recording based on customer needs. Requests checks for county filing fees from Accounts Payable as needed
Ensures proper recording of release of lien in county records. Prepares communication to accompany documents returned to customer post-termination
Assists with various projects associated with loan servicing, lien verification, and system conversion including collateral record cleanup, compliance monitoring records cleanup, property tax verification, and borrower contact information updates
Maintains knowledge of, and assists with, ensuring compliance with required procedures, policies, processes, internal controls, and regulations with an ability to research and apply them with some oversight
Maintains foundational knowledge of multiple systems and programs and demonstrates the ability to use CFC programs and systems used in lending
